2nd millennium BC. A terracotta plaque depicting Humbaba, the monstrous giant who was the guardian of the Cedar Forest, with staring eyes, grinning mouth with exposed teeth; mounted on a custom-made display stand. 154 grams total, 12cm including stand (4 3/4"). Property of a London gentleman; acquired on the London art market in the 2000s.
